Prince Harry could be stripped of his US residence permit for admitting to using illegal drugs. Harry summed up all the mistakes of youth in his memoirs, but, apparently, in vain.
Legal expert Neamah Rahmani told the Daily Mail that the law applies equally to everyone, including the royal family. Therefore, the origin of the prince in this case will not help.

“Admission to drug use is often the reason for visa refusal. “This means that Prince Harry should have been denied or rescinded for admitting to using cocaine, mushrooms and other drugs,” Neamah Rahmani said.
Harry wrote in his memoirs that he started using illegal drugs and alcohol after the death of his mother, Princess Diana.
